| package org.apache.activemq.filter; |
| |
| import javax.jms.JMSException; |
| |
| /** |
| * An expression which performs an operation on two expression values |
| * |
| * |
| */ |
| public abstract class ArithmeticExpression extends BinaryExpression { |
| |
| protected static final int INTEGER = 1; |
| protected static final int LONG = 2; |
| protected static final int DOUBLE = 3; |
| |
| /** |
| * @param left |
| * @param right |
| */ |
| public ArithmeticExpression(Expression left, Expression right) { |
| super(left, right); |
| } |
| |
| public static Expression createPlus(Expression left, Expression right) { |
| return new ArithmeticExpression(left, right) { |
| protected Object evaluate(Object lvalue, Object rvalue) { |
| if (lvalue instanceof String) { |
| String text = (String)lvalue; |
| String answer = text + rvalue; |
| return answer; |
| } else if (lvalue instanceof Number) { |
| return plus((Number)lvalue, asNumber(rvalue)); |
| } |
| throw new RuntimeException("Cannot call plus operation on: " + lvalue + " and: " + rvalue); |
| } |
| |
| public String getExpressionSymbol() { |
| return "+"; |
| } |
| }; |
| } |
| |
| public static Expression createMinus(Expression left, Expression right) { |
| return new ArithmeticExpression(left, right) { |
| protected Object evaluate(Object lvalue, Object rvalue) { |
| if (lvalue instanceof Number) { |
| return minus((Number)lvalue, asNumber(rvalue)); |
| } |
| throw new RuntimeException("Cannot call minus operation on: " + lvalue + " and: " + rvalue); |
| } |
| |
| public String getExpressionSymbol() { |
| return "-"; |
| } |
| }; |
| } |
| |
| public static Expression createMultiply(Expression left, Expression right) { |
| return new ArithmeticExpression(left, right) { |
| |
| protected Object evaluate(Object lvalue, Object rvalue) { |
| if (lvalue instanceof Number) { |
| return multiply((Number)lvalue, asNumber(rvalue)); |
| } |
| throw new RuntimeException("Cannot call multiply operation on: " + lvalue + " and: " + rvalue); |
| } |
| |
| public String getExpressionSymbol() { |
| return "*"; |
| } |
| }; |
| } |
| |
| public static Expression createDivide(Expression left, Expression right) { |
| return new ArithmeticExpression(left, right) { |
| |
| protected Object evaluate(Object lvalue, Object rvalue) { |
| if (lvalue instanceof Number) { |
| return divide((Number)lvalue, asNumber(rvalue)); |
| } |
| throw new RuntimeException("Cannot call divide operation on: " + lvalue + " and: " + rvalue); |
| } |
| |
| public String getExpressionSymbol() { |
| return "/"; |
| } |
| }; |
| } |
| |
| public static Expression createMod(Expression left, Expression right) { |
| return new ArithmeticExpression(left, right) { |
| |
| protected Object evaluate(Object lvalue, Object rvalue) { |
| if (lvalue instanceof Number) { |
| return mod((Number)lvalue, asNumber(rvalue)); |
| } |
| throw new RuntimeException("Cannot call mod operation on: " + lvalue + " and: " + rvalue); |
| } |
| |
| public String getExpressionSymbol() { |
| return "%"; |
| } |
| }; |
| } |
| |
| protected Number plus(Number left, Number right) { |
| switch (numberType(left, right)) { |
| case INTEGER: |
| return new Integer(left.intValue() + right.intValue()); |
| case LONG: |
| return new Long(left.longValue() + right.longValue()); |
| default: |
| return new Double(left.doubleValue() + right.doubleValue()); |
| } |
| } |
| |
| protected Number minus(Number left, Number right) { |
| switch (numberType(left, right)) { |
| case INTEGER: |
| return new Integer(left.intValue() - right.intValue()); |
| case LONG: |
| return new Long(left.longValue() - right.longValue()); |
| default: |
| return new Double(left.doubleValue() - right.doubleValue()); |
| } |
| } |
| |
| protected Number multiply(Number left, Number right) { |
| switch (numberType(left, right)) { |
| case INTEGER: |
| return new Integer(left.intValue() * right.intValue()); |
| case LONG: |
| return new Long(left.longValue() * right.longValue()); |
| default: |
| return new Double(left.doubleValue() * right.doubleValue()); |
| } |
| } |
| |
| protected Number divide(Number left, Number right) { |
| return new Double(left.doubleValue() / right.doubleValue()); |
| } |
| |
| protected Number mod(Number left, Number right) { |
| return new Double(left.doubleValue() % right.doubleValue()); |
| } |
| |
| private int numberType(Number left, Number right) { |
| if (isDouble(left) || isDouble(right)) { |
| return DOUBLE; |
| } else if (left instanceof Long || right instanceof Long) { |
| return LONG; |
| } else { |
| return INTEGER; |
| } |
| } |
| |
| private boolean isDouble(Number n) { |
| return n instanceof Float || n instanceof Double; |
| } |
| |
| protected Number asNumber(Object value) { |
| if (value instanceof Number) { |
| return (Number)value; |
| } else { |
| throw new RuntimeException("Cannot convert value: " + value + " into a number"); |
| } |
| } |
| |
| public Object evaluate(MessageEvaluationContext message) throws JMSException { |
| Object lvalue = left.evaluate(message); |
| if (lvalue == null) { |
| return null; |
| } |
| Object rvalue = right.evaluate(message); |
| if (rvalue == null) { |
| return null; |
| } |
| return evaluate(lvalue, rvalue); |
| } |
| |
| /** |
| * @param lvalue |
| * @param rvalue |
| * @return |
| */ |
| protected abstract Object evaluate(Object lvalue, Object rvalue); |
| |
| } |
